FAQs about Project Documentation Services
What is Documentation-as-a-Service?
Documentation-as-a-Service refers to outsourced document management solutions that handle the complete documentation lifecycle of projects, from creation to archiving, ensuring that all procedures are streamlined and conform to the best practices.
How Do Project Recovery Consultants Work?
Project recovery consultants analyze troubled projects to diagnose problems and implement corrective measures, ensuring that projects can move forward successfully after a setback.
